(a) An authority may issue revenue bonds at any time and for any amounts it considers necessary or appropriate for:
- (1) the acquisition, construction, repair, equipping, improvement, or extension of its transit system; or
- (2) the construction or general maintenance of streets of the creating municipality.
- (b) Bonds payable solely from revenues may be issued by resolution of the board.
- (c) Bonds, other than refunding bonds, any portion of which is payable from tax revenue may not be issued until authorized by a majority vote of the voters of the authority voting in an election.
